6 FAQs about [Structure diagram of wind farm energy storage system]

Which energy storage systems are used in wind farms?

Therefore, energy storage systems are used to smooth the fluctuations of wind farm output power. In this chapter, several common energy storage systems used in wind farms such as SMES, FES, supercapacitor, and battery are presented in detail. Among these energy storage systems, the FES, SMES, and supercapacitors have fast response.

How a battery is connected to a wind farm?

Battery connected to wind farm Methods such as step angle control, inertial use, and energy storage systems are used to reduce wind power output fluctuations. Batteries are also used as storage in combination with wind farms to control the frequency and reduce the power fluctuations.

What is a wind storage system?

A storage system, such as a Li-ion battery, can help maintain balance of variable wind power output within system constraints, delivering firm power that is easy to integrate with other generators or the grid. The size and use of storage depend on the intended application and the configuration of the wind devices.

What are the challenges faced by wind energy storage systems?

Energy storage systems in wind turbines With the rapid growth in wind energy deployment, power system operations have confronted various challenges with high penetration levels of wind energy such as voltage and frequency control, power quality, low-voltage ride-through, reliability, stability, wind power prediction, security, and power management.

What is co-locating energy storage with a wind power plant?

Co-locating energy storage with a wind power plant allows the uncertain, time-varying electric power output from wind turbines to be smoothed out, enabling reliable, dispatchable energy for local loads to the local microgrid or the larger grid.

What is integrated storage in a wind turbine?

An integrated storage in the DC link of the wind turbine may function as an external auxiliary source during the operation. For a microgrid with more than one inverter, a superordinate plant control is required to coordinate various stages of the black start among the inverters.
